Requirements to Deliver:
- Be at least 18 years old
- Have the right to work in the UK (and documents to support this)
- Access to your own delivery vehicle (bike, motorbike, car)
- Insulated bag for food delivery
- A smartphone (for navigation and delivery app use)

How to Sign Up:
- Click to sign up and complete your registration process.
- Submit the required documents depending on the vehicle you will deliver with.
- Complete a background check.
- Once approved, download the app and get started.
